Transaction 827905db0410220675f5fa4f3225120e7bbfb0a293df8d970746df1796bb359a
1 Input
1 Output
-
827905db0410220675f5fa4f3225120e7bbfb0a293df8d970746df1796bb359a:0
- value
- 578019
- script pubkey
- OP_0 OP_PUSHBYTES_32 c6b0db1fc81e0dd4c319b8ad18ec1a3693b813c3816d83abb7e74480f444900e
- address
- bc1qc6cdk87grcxafscehzk33mq6x6fmsy7rs9kc82ahuazgpazyjq8qclskex